On October 10, 2024, Sailors, students, and civilians assigned to Naval Justice School (NJS), Newport, Rhode Island gathered at NJS to honor the Navy’s 249th birthday with a not-so-traditional
pie cutting. ABFC Gabriel hosted the ceremony and gave the opening remarks and naval history, stating “Our Navy’s legacy is built upon a foundation of honor, courage, and commitment...which have guided our sailors throughout generations, inspiring them to overcome adversity and serve with distinction.” Additionally, LT Barbour served as the guest speaker and reminded the legal professionals in the room how they all play a role in Admiral Lisa Franchetti’s, the Chief of Naval
Operations, Navigation Plan. Specifically, LT Barbour focused on the legal professionals’ roles in Ready our Platforms and how they are key in ensuring that war fighters are legally ready and then therefore mission ready. Lastly, LT Barbour focused on how the Naval Justice School plays a major
role in Investind in Warfighting Competency.
